基于开发者空间的电商数据迁移:MySQL 到 GaussDB 的奇幻之旅

📰 案例概览
🚀 背景与简介
云数据库 GaussDB 是华为自主创新研发的分布式关系型数据库。该产品具备企业级复杂事务混合负载能力,同时支持分布式事务,同城跨 AZ 部署,数据 0 丢失,支持 1000+的扩展能力,PB 级海量存储。同时拥有云上高可用,高可靠,高安全,弹性伸缩,一键部署,快速备份恢复,监控告警等关键能力,能为企业提供功能全面,稳定可靠,扩展性强,性能优越的企业级数据库服务。
通过该案例,大家可以学习 GaussDB 数据库的简单使用,并在代码中如何通过 JDBC 驱动操作数据库,体验数据应用和迁移 UGO 服务的 SQL 转换能力,助力数据库迁移。
🎯 案例优势:
1. GaussDB 整合了华为硬件体系,从硬件到软件多层次优化,相比国产数据库,大大提升性能。
2. GaussDB 做为云数据库,在公有云平台上简化部署与运维监控。让数据库管理工作更简化。
🥏 案例流程

🕹️ 流程说明:
下载电商项目代码;
安装 Redis 数据库;
购买 &初始化 GaussDB 数据库;
改造电商项目;
运行电商项目。
✍️ 案例实操
📚 电商数据迁移:MySQL到GaussDB的奇幻之旅 👈👈👈体验完整版案例,点击这里
从 gitcode 下载 E-Commerce-Java 和 E-Commerce-Web 代码仓。
登陆开发者空间云主机,用命令安装 Redis 数据库。
进入云数据库 GaussDB 控制台,购买集中式|4C|16GB|40GB|1 主 1 备 1 日志,并初始化数据库;
进开发者空间云主机,使用 CodeArts IDE For Java 工具打开 E-Commerce-Java 项目,使用 JDK1.8 和 GaussDB 官方驱动,修改并配置项目中链接字符内容。
安装 node 和 npm,进入项目 E-Commerce-Web,执行 npm run dev 并运行电商项目。
🌈 案例最终结果

评论